Abstract :
With the development of Internet and information sharing, semantic web attracts many re-searchers´ attention in computer field. Web service composition is an important technology in domain of Web service. As integrated solution for realizing the vision of the next generation of the web, semantic web services combine the semantic web technology with web service technology, and thus enable automated discovery, selection, composition and execution of web services. Ontology is the theoretical foundation of semantic web services. Qos ontology of web services description is introduced. In this paper, a new composition algorithm of semantic Web service based on QoS ontology is proposed. Experiments are carried out to compare the new algorithm with some other web service composition algorithms.
